About Thomas Lohner

Thomas Lohner is a scholar working on Mechanical Engineering, Mechanics of Materials, Materials Chemistry, Control and Systems Engineering and Electrical and Electronic Engineering, having authored 95 papers that have together received 1.2k indexed citations. Recurring topics across this work include Gear and Bearing Dynamics Analysis (62 papers), Tribology and Lubrication Engineering (50 papers), Lubricants and Their Additives (32 papers), Adhesion, Friction, and Surface Interactions (23 papers), Tribology and Wear Analysis (22 papers), Hydraulic and Pneumatic Systems (13 papers), Advanced machining processes and optimization (11 papers) and Diamond and Carbon-based Materials Research (8 papers). The work is most often cited by research in Mechanical Engineering (1.1k citations), Mechanics of Materials (471 citations), Automotive Engineering (50 citations), Materials Chemistry (152 citations) and Fluid Flow and Transfer Processes (19 citations). Thomas Lohner has collaborated with scholars based in Germany, Czechia and Sweden. Frequent co-authors include Karsten Stahl, Klaus Michaelis, Hua Liu, Bernd‐Robert Höhn, Kirsten Bobzin, C. Kalscheuer, T. Brögelmann, J.R.R. Mayer, Martin Hartl and Miloš Stanić. Their work appears in journals such as Forschung im Ingenieurwesen, Lubricants, Tribology International, Tribology Letters and Proceedings of the Institution of Mechanical Engineers Part J Journal of Engineering Tribology.
